I have two IP 440 Nokias running in HA with CheckPoint v.4.0 Enterprise
FW-1. My NATing (manual) is acting very suspicious. The NATing is working
fine but then all of a sudden it stops. I have to bounce the primary Nokia
box to get it going again. I think that this is only isolated to the
primary box.
These are the steps I followed to get NAT enabled:
Define network object with an interface (the NATed IP address)
Make the firewall policy to allow the proper services to get across
(e.g., TELNET)
Create a NAT rule
Make a static route entry for the NATed IP address (on both Nokias)
Make a VRRP entry for the NATed IP address (on both Nokias)
I have gone over my configuration many, many times before. I only have
about 50 regular policy rules, 80 NAT rules, and 5 rulebases. This
configuration (slightly different) was originally on NT boxes. The Nokias
are far more powerful then the old NT boxes. That is why I think it may be
somewhere in the configuration. I am working with my Reseller but they do
not have a solution yet.
